1.2.3.17. .Pension.Comm..of.Univ..of.Montreal.
Pension.Plan.v..Bank.of.Am..
Secs.,.LLC.(S.D.N.Y.1/15/10)
This.is.another.case.ruling.by.Judge.Scheindlin.(of.Zubulake.
fame).. In. this. case. the. judge. addresses. electronic. evidence.
preservation.obligations.and.spoliation.in.great.detail.
She.includes.some.important.discussions.on.culpability.of.
the.litigating.parties.for.the.preservation.and.production.of.
evidence,.as.well.as.burdens.of.proof.for.the.parties.to.com-
ply.with.in.presenting.their.evidence..Finally,.she.discusses.
appropriate. remedies. when. these. guidelines. and. rules. are.
not.followed.

1.2.3.18. .Holmes.v..Petrovich.Development.
Company,.LLC.(CA.Court.of.Appeals,.
October,.2011)—Employee's.E-mail.
Sent.from.Work.Not.Privileged
This. is. another. example. where. someone. lost. their. attor-
ney-client. privilege. by. virtue. of. a. very. well-written. and.
published.privacy.and.acceptable.use.policy.on.the.part.of.
an.organization.
The.plaintiff.Holmes.e-mailed.her.attorney.using.her.per-
sonal.e-mail.from.her.work.computer.to.ask.about.discrimina-
tion..When.she.was.terminated,.the.company.she.worked.for,.
Petrovich,.preserved.the.data.from.her.computer.and.eventu-
ally.those.e-mails.were.used.in.the.court.matter.
